The Role of AI in Personalized Health Monitoring and Wellbeing
In recent years, artificial intelligence (AI) has emerged as a transformative force in various industries, with healthcare being one of the most significantly impacted sectors. The role of AI in personalized health monitoring and wellbeing is evolving rapidly, enabling more tailored healthcare solutions that align with individual needs.
One of the most notable applications of AI in personalized health monitoring is through wearable technology. Devices like smartwatches and fitness trackers utilize AI algorithms to collect and analyze data on heart rates, sleep patterns, activity levels, and more. These wearables empower users to monitor their health in real time, providing insights that can lead to healthier lifestyle choices.
Furthermore, AI-driven apps personalize health recommendations based on user data. For instance, by utilizing machine learning techniques, these applications can analyze an individual’s habits and preferences to suggest tailored diet plans, exercise routines, and even stress management techniques. This bespoke approach helps users achieve their health goals more effectively and sustainably.
Another significant benefit of AI in personalized healthcare is predictive analytics. By analyzing vast amounts of medical data, AI can identify patterns and predict potential health risks before they materialize. This proactive approach allows healthcare providers to tailor their interventions based on individual risk profiles, enhancing preventive care.
AI’s capability to analyze large sets of data is also crucial in managing chronic conditions. For those suffering from diabetes or heart disease, AI solutions can continuously monitor vital signs and provide alerts when abnormalities occur. This real-time monitoring enables timely medical responses and empowers patients to manage their conditions more effectively.
The integration of AI in telemedicine is revolutionizing patient care by facilitating personalized consultations. Virtual health assistants powered by AI can collect preliminary health information, enabling healthcare providers to offer tailored advice and prescriptions remotely. This not only saves time but also ensures that patients receive attention that is specifically catered to their health profiles.
Moreover, AI's ability to learn from patient data means that its accuracy and personalization capabilities will only improve over time. Continuous engagement through AI-powered platforms encourages users to remain informed and proactive about their health, which can lead to improved health outcomes and overall wellbeing.
However, as with any technology, ethical considerations must be taken into account. The use of AI in health monitoring raises concerns about data privacy and security. It is crucial for developers and healthcare providers to adhere to strict guidelines to protect patient information and maintain trust.
